    What are the possible reasons for my Check Engine Light Came on in my 96 honda civic
    My check engine light came on in my 96 honda civic dx coupe Friday morning on my way to school. It was cold and I didn't give it time to warm up because I was running late. It was a very bumpy ride to school but drove home fine. The light came on as soon as I started it. It has only traveled about 3 miles since the light has came on. What are the possible reasons for the light to come on if I can't tell what the problem is and it seems to be driving well?
  • Oct 1, 2005, 06:23 PM
    CroCivic91
    There are a lot of possible reasons. 96+ Civics are OBD-II, which means they have to be connected to a computer to read out error codes. Just take it to a shop and ask them to read out codes for you. It will tell you what error caused your check engine light to turn on.
